Joinder of Borrowers and Guarantors Sample Clauses

Joinder of Borrowers and Guarantors. (i) Each Domestic Material Subsidiary acquired, formed or in existence after the Closing Date shall be required to, and, each Foreign Subsidiary upon electing to do so may, become a Borrower or a Guarantor hereunder, and the Borrowers and the Guarantors shall complete all of the following steps in clauses (a) and (b) below within thirty (30) days (unless such time period is extended in writing by the Administrative Agent) after the date of organization or acquisition of (or in the case of a Foreign Subsidiary, election by) such Subsidiary: (a) cause such Person to sign and join in this Agreement or the Guarantee and Collateral Agreement by execution and delivery to the Administrative Agent of one or more counterparts of a Joinder hereto in the form attached hereto as Exhibit 11.20(A) or Exhibit 11.20(B) (each, as the case may be, a "Borrower Joinder" or "Guarantor Joinder"), appropriately dated, (b) deliver to the Administrative Agent all certificates and other documents referred to in Section 7 of this Agreement and such Borrower Joinder or Guarantor Joinder and (c) deliver to the Administrative Agent documents necessary to grant and perfect Prior Security Interests to the Administrative Agent for the benefit of the Banks in all Pledged Collateral held by the owners of such Subsidiary if it is a Foreign Subsidiary owned directly by a Domestic Loan Party. The Borrowers covenant and agree to cause all Domestic Material Subsidiaries to comply with the terms of this Section 11.20(i). Notwithstanding the foregoing, each new Borrower shall not be permitted to borrow under this Agreement until the following number of Business Days has elapsed after a fully executed Borrower Joinder has been delivered to the Banks: (i) five (5) with respect to a Domestic Borrower and (ii) ten (10) with respect to a Foreign Borrower.

Joinder of Borrowers and Guarantors. Any Subsidiary of the Borrower which is required to join this Agreement as a Borrower pursuant to Section 7.2.9 [Subsidiaries, Partnerships and Joint Ventures] and any Person permitted or required to be a Guarantor hereunder shall execute and deliver to the Agent (i) a Joinder in substantially the form attached hereto as Exhibit 1.1(J) or Exhibit 1.1(G) pursuant to which it shall join as a Borrower or as a Guarantor respectively in each of the Loan Documents to which a Borrower and a Guarantor are a party; (ii) documents in the forms described in Section 6.1 [First Loans] modified as appropriate to relate to such Subsidiary or new Guarantor; and (iii) documents necessary to grant and perfect Prior Security Interests to the Agent for the benefit of the Banks in all Collateral held by such Subsidiary or new Guarantor. The Loan Parties shall deliver such Joinder and related documents to the Agent within five (5) Business Days after the date of the filing of such Subsidiary's or new Guarantor's articles of incorporation if such party is a newly-formed corporation, the date of the filing of its certificate of limited partnership if it is a newly-formed limited partnership or the date of its organization if it is a newly-formed entity other than a limited partnership or corporation or the date of its acquisition by the Borrower if permitted.
Joinder of Borrowers and Guarantors. Any Subsidiary of any of the Borrowers which is required to join this Agreement as a Borrower and a Guarantor pursuant to Section 7.2.9 shall execute and deliver to the Agent (i) a Borrower Joinder and a Guarantor Joinder in substantially the form attached hereto as Exhibit 1.1(G)(1) pursuant to which it ----------------- shall join as a Borrower and a Guarantor each of the documents to which the Borrowers and Guarantors are parties; (ii) documents in the forms described in Section 6.1 (First Loans) modified as appropriate to relate to such Subsidiary; and (iii) documents necessary to grant and perfect Prior Security Interests to the Agent for the benefit of the Banks in all Collateral held by such Subsidiary. The Loan Parties shall deliver such Borrower Joinder and Guarantor Joinder and related documents to the Agent within five (5) Business Days after the date of the filing of such Subsidiary's articles of incorporation if the Subsidiary is a corporation, the date of the filing of its certificate of limited partnership if it is a limited partnership or the date of its organization if it is an entity other than a limited partnership or corporation.

  • Additional Borrowers Other investment companies (or series of investment companies), in addition to those Borrowers which are original signatories to this Agreement, may, with the written approval of all the Banks, become parties to this Agreement and be deemed Tranche A Borrowers for all purposes of this Agreement by executing an instrument substantially in the form of Exhibit G hereto (with such changes therein may be approved by the Banks), which instrument shall (i) have attached to it a copy of this Agreement (as the same may have been amended) with a revised Allocation Notice reflecting the participation of such additional investment company and (ii) be accompanied by the documents and instruments required to be delivered by the Borrowers pursuant to Section 3.1 hereof, including, without limitation, an opinion of counsel for such Borrower, in a form reasonably satisfactory to the Administrative Agent and its counsel; provided, that the joinder of any additional Borrower shall be effective no earlier than five (5) Business Days following receipt by the Banks of such documents and information requested by the Administrative Agent or any Bank that are reasonably required in order to comply with “know-your-customer” and other anti-terrorism, anti-money laundering and similar rules and regulations, including without limitation the USA PATRIOT Act; and provided, further, that no such additional Borrower shall be added unless each of the Banks consent, except that (A) to the extent an existing Borrower converts to a “master/feeder” structure, no consent shall be required for the master trust in such structure to become a Borrower hereunder after such conversion, provided the converting Borrower ceases to be a Borrower hereunder on or prior to such conversion and provided that such master trust is formed under the laws of a State in the United States and (B) to the extent that an existing Borrower which is a “master trust” is merged into (or transfers all or substantially all of its assets and liabilities to) its feeder fund (the “Former Feeder Fund”), no consent shall be required for such Former Feeder Fund to become a Borrower if in connection with such merger or transfer such Former Feeder Fund shall hold all or substantially all the assets and liabilities of the prior master trust, such Former Feeder Fund is formed under the laws of a State in the United States and, prior to such merger or transfer, such Former Feeder Fund shall have no Debt. Additional Borrowers may be added to this Agreement only once per each calendar quarter. Each new Borrower added to the Credit Facility after the addition of five (5) new Borrowers shall pay a new Borrower’s fee in the amount of $1,500 to the Administrative Agent, provided that the Administrative Agent may, in its sole discretion, waive the requirement to pay such fee. To the extent that the Banks deem that the Permitted Asset Coverage Ratio is insufficient with respect to any Additional Borrower, the Joinder in which such Additional Borrower becomes a Borrower may, with the agreement of such Additional Borrower and each Bank, contain language amending this Agreement to provide for a different Permitted Asset Coverage Ratio with respect to such Additional Borrower.

  • Designation of Lead Borrower as Borrowers’ Agent (a) Each Borrower hereby irrevocably designates and appoints the Lead Borrower as such Borrower’s agent to obtain Credit Extensions, the proceeds of which shall be available to each Borrower for such uses as are permitted under this Agreement. As the disclosed principal for its agent, each Borrower shall be obligated to each Credit Party on account of Credit Extensions so made as if made directly by the applicable Credit Party to such Borrower, notwithstanding the manner by which such Credit Extensions are recorded on the books and records of the Lead Borrower and of any other Borrower. In addition, each Loan Party other than the Borrowers hereby irrevocably designates and appoints the Lead Borrower as such Loan Party’s agent to represent such Loan Party in all respects under this Agreement and the other Loan Documents.

  • Co-Borrowers Borrowers are jointly and severally liable for the Obligations and Bank may proceed against one Borrower to enforce the Obligations without waiving its right to proceed against any other Borrower. This Agreement and the Loan Documents are a primary and original obligation of each Borrower and shall remain in effect notwithstanding future changes in conditions, including any change of law or any invalidity or irregularity in the creation or acquisition of any Obligations or in the execution or delivery of any agreement between Bank and any Borrower. Each Borrower shall be liable for existing and future Obligations as fully as if all of the Credit Extensions were advanced to such Borrower. Bank may rely on any certificate or representation made by any Borrower as made on behalf of, and binding on, all Borrowers, including without limitation advance request forms and compliance certificates. Each Borrower appoints each other Borrower as its agent with all necessary power and authority to give and receive notices, certificates or demands for and on behalf of all Borrowers, to act as disbursing agent for receipt of any Credit Extensions on behalf of each Borrower and to apply to Bank on behalf of each Borrower for any Credit Extension, any waivers and any consents. This authorization cannot be revoked, and Bank need not inquire as to one Borrower’s authority to act for or on behalf of another Borrower.
